Output 2ba65233268b9a74c321db955a9ff27128746260c2c3f3830878d6562645da36:0

value
95369413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55ed0af9e4bf5f8e79bebeaf6aece93e146ccacf OP_EQUAL
address
MFjVdmEh8JiPtANRfiukqA84i12GGVH52q
transaction
2ba65233268b9a74c321db955a9ff27128746260c2c3f3830878d6562645da36
spent
true